Kayaking in Massachusetts: Exploring the Serene Waters of Kettle Cove
Nestled along the rugged North Shore of Massachusetts, Kettle Cove has become a cherished destination for kayakers seeking a tranquil and scenic paddling experience. This picturesque bay, located within the coastal town of Manchester-by-the-Sea, offers a sheltered water body that is well-suited for a wide range of paddlers, from families with children to experienced touring kayakers.
The North Shore region of Massachusetts is renowned for its diverse array of paddling opportunities, from the protected estuaries and inlets of Cape Ann to the open waters of the Atlantic Ocean. Kettle Cove, situated in the heart of this coastal landscape, represents a quintessential example of the type of bay-class waterbody that is highly prized by local and visiting kayakers alike.
